Position Overview:

We're seeking a Risk Governance Lead for Investments & Capital Markets to support enterprise risk programs in Data and AI. Our Impact:

The Data and AI Risk & Governance Lead will play a meaningful role in driving divisional objectives for data governance and implementing the safe and effective use of AI technologies within our firm. You'll collaborate across teams to drive risk management strategies.

Your Impact:

Engage with multiple partners across all divisions and risk domains affording opportunities to build robust relationships across the Enterprise. Responsibilities include:

Partner Collaboration: Work with legal, technical, and business teams to communicate risk findings and drive informed decision-making.

Risk Assessment and Remediation: Conduct comprehensive risk assessments of divisional data management and AI projects and recommend mitigation strategies.

Policy Development: Develop and maintain AI governance guidance, ensuring alignment across the organization considering industry standards and regulatory requirements.

Ethical AI Advocacy: Promote transparency, fairness, and accountability in AI practices.

Security Support: Work closely with Information security teams to advise data management practices and address AI-specific security risks.

Compliance Oversight: Monitor for adherence to data and AI policies and standards, offering guidance as needed.

Training and Awareness: Help develop enterprise training to raise awareness of data management and AI risks and standard methodologies

Metrics and Reporting: Partner on crafting appropriate enterprise KPIs, KRIs and Reporting to monitor risk in model data and AI programs.

Qualifications:

8+ years of relevant experience with a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ent experience.

6+ years of experience in operational risk management including exposure to technology risk, information risk and/or model risk management

2-5 years of management and leadership experience

Strong knowledge of Data Management standard methodologies and AI technologies (e.g. machine learning, natural language processing, large language models and computer vision)

Familiarity with relevant regulations (e.g., GDPR, CCPA) and industry guidelines (e.g., IEEE Ethically Aligned Design, NIST, ISO/IEC 42001/ 23894)

Excellent communication skills and collaborate skills
